Manyo Botanical Gardens, located in Nara, Japan, is a beautifully curated garden that showcases a diverse array of flora, offering a tranquil and inspiring setting for photographers. Named after the ancient Manyoshu poetry anthology, the gardens feature plants mentioned in these classical poems, creating a unique blend of natural beauty and cultural heritage. The gardens are meticulously designed with winding paths, serene ponds, and seasonal flowers, providing picturesque scenes throughout the year. In spring, cherry blossoms and azaleas add vibrant colors, while summer brings lush greenery and irises. Autumn offers a stunning display of red and gold foliage, and winter showcases the elegant simplicity of evergreens and camellias. The garden's layout, with its traditional Japanese aesthetic, offers numerous opportunities to capture the harmony between nature and art. Located near Kasuga Taisha Shrine, Manyo Botanical Gardens are easily accessible and provide a peaceful retreat for photographers seeking to capture the timeless beauty of Japanese landscapes.
